A new DAF 18t LF 250 truck and Fassi F110B for Parker Building Supplies
East Grinstead (United Kingdom) – 17th November. On 15th November Parker Building Supplies, a company dealing in the supply and distribution of commercial and domestic building materials and equipment in the South East of England, took delivery of its last new vehicle for this year, a DAF 18t LF 250 truck with Charlton Bodywork and a Fassi F110B remote control crane. The vehicle will be used to deliver building materials throughout the region. Courtesy of Fassi UK.

Barcelona (Spain) – 9th November. On 18th October Fassi’s Spanish dealer, Transgrúas Cial S.L, worked together with client Estructuras Metálicas Cañellas, a Mallorcan metal structures firm, to mount the first ever F1650RA xe-dynamic crane to a 4-axle MERCEDES AROCS 4148. The crane is configured with 8 hydraulic extensions, 3 tn hydraulic winch, hydraulic extension L816 with Dual Power Jib (DPJ) and the new SCANRECO V7 radio from FASSI with a large graphic display. Courtesy of Transgrúas Cial S.L.
Two classes from the school IC GAZZANIGA - CENE guests at the Fassi Group headquarters
Albino (Italy) - 11 November. During the morning of Friday 11 November, 40 pupils aged between 12 and 14 from the secondary school in Cene - Gazzaniga were guests at the headquarters of the Fassi Group. During the visit, the children had the opportunity to discover the various aspects of production and understand what professional abilities are most required within the Albino-based industrial group, leader in the lifting sector. The “PMI DAY” (day for Small and Medium sized enterprises) was an ideal opportunity for the entrepreneurs to pass to new generations from the area the pride and passion of doing business; the hard work and talent that they share with their employees in the creation of products and services.

Velesmes-Essarts (France) – 28th October. A Fassi F365A.2.26 e-dynamic crane fitted on a two-axle tractor unit was recently delivered to the company Transports Bourgeois. This company is headquartered in Velesmes-Essarts, near Besançon in the department of Doubs, Franche-Comté, and it has been operational since 1975. The F365A.2.26 e-dynamic has a lifting capacity of 31.70 ton/m and a hydraulic outreach that can reach up to 16.70 m. Courtesy of Fassi France (C. Lima)
Łódź (Poland) - 3rd November. Last Monday the Polish dealer for Fassi, HEWEA, brought 3 out of 4 F170AT.14 cranes purchased by the Polish national police force to the headquarters in Łódź. The cranes will assist with the clearing of streets after road accidents and to help ease the flow of traffic. Fassi’s products were fitted to MAN TGM 15.290 4x2 BL trucks equipped with edges, enabling the transference of barricades and physical evidence. Courtesy of Hewea (Ł. Olszewski)

A Mercedes vehicle for road rescue fitted with a Fassi F235A.2.23 e-dynamic
Beaune (France) - 25th October. A Fassi F235A.2.23 e-dynamic crane fitted on a Mercedes Antos model 2543 truck designed for road rescues. This vehicle, aside from the Fassi crane, is also equipped with a winch and a generous-sized tilting truck bed to guarantee rescue even for commercial vehicles and highly cumbersome caravans. The fitting was done by the company Jige International, specialised in vehicles fitted for road rescues, even for heavy vehicles. Courtesy of Fassi France (C. Lima).
Fassi Gru S.p.A. - Loader cranes manufacturer since 1965
Fassi Gru is the market leader among Italian producers. Its product range and sales numbers place it among the top producers of hydraulic cranes in the world.
Fassi’s production potential is approximately 12,000 cranes per year. The entire range is exported and distributed throughout the world through an efficient and widespread distribution network. From Canada to France, from the UK to Australia, Fassi’s professionalism is reflected in the company’s aim to meet different market needs, which are often linked to the specific geographical and economic conditions of individual countries.
